Make a "vendor bundle."A vendor bundle contains all the frameworks and libraries each application feature depends on. Plus it has methods for images and JavaScript as well. What Does a Cache-Buster Code Look Like? Cache Busting is the process of appending some query parameter in the URLs of static resources such as JS, CSS or image file. When making a second request it sends (depending on the caching configuration in the headers) some information to validate if the files have been . 0 sumitshah created 2 years ago #8427. This caching is one of the most important things to do when optimizing websites which ultimately saves a lot of data for end uses/visitors . In the root of the solution create /build/post-build.js ( build is the same folder level as src ). Project has three partials as html files in templates directory. Even in that case the index.html file could still be cached as angular doesn't output hash that file. Cache busting for AngularJS partials is easy · GitHub npm.io. Caching tip. Angular I can see that the service worker runs. This option utilizes the gulp-rev plugin. These can be configured at the server to store these assets for a longer time and these will be expired with the time specified. <system.webServer>. Prerequisiteslink. The examples in this guide stem from getting started, output management and code splitting.. Edit: unless you're using a service worker which is caching index.html. For . Add no-cache in the index.html file. Automatic Cache Busting for Your CSS - RisingStack Source: AngularJS. but none of them are working properly. From Angular Documentation: Define the output filename cache-busting hashing mode. I created example AngularJS project, where is used Gulp to minify and do Cache Busting for release version of site in public folder. We are facing the browser cache refresh issue. If anyone has implemented the same please help. angular cache busting - a suggested solution #8822 - ASP.NET Zero What is the use of -output-hashing=all in angular build? On the next request, it's going to hit the cache and not have to make the http call! So, if your parameter is all, your generated files would look like: main.62beb1fb93041eb44194.js. Browser Cache Busting Explained: How & Why to Use Cachebust To achieve this, the Angular service worker follows these guidelines: Caching an application is like installing a native application. Fig. When a browser requests the server to get a static file, the browser will download this file, and then it will cache them to improve & optimize performance. Let's first define what the cache does. Angular CLI - ng build Command - Tutorials Point If a file is "stored forever" on a visitor's computer, we as developers must have a way to update that file at some point in the future. I deploy to production servers. Cache busting is not working sometimes after production build in angular 7. Combining JavaScript bundling, minification, cache busting, and easier ...
La Balançoire Andrée Chedid Analyse,
Agence De Voyage Mariage à Létranger,
Chogan France Contact,
Geraldine Chaplin Frères Et Sœurs,
Poème Mariage Pour Mes Parents,
Articles W